Support - Advocacy – Awareness – Education

Sleep Disorders Australia (SDA) is the peak consumer body for sleep disorders in Australia. As a voluntary, NFP charity, we are committed to advocating for the needs of people with sleep disorders. We work with a range of sleep health professionals, organisations, research centres and peak bodies (including the Woolcock Institute of Medical Research, Australasian Sleep Association, Hypersomnolence Australia and the Sleep Health Foundation) to raise awareness of sleep disorders and the significance they can have on the lives of those affected by them.

Our work includes:

We represent and advocate for people with sleep disorders and liaise with key stakeholders including pharma, Government, clinicians and researchers.

We maintain a website that includes a range of factsheets and other information that you can download and share.

We participate as consumer and patient advocates/advisors on research projects and clinical trials.

FREE second hand PAP machine advertising on our website for all members to sell preloved equipment. Non-members are also welcome to advertise.

Regular Member Newsletters and social media channels including Facebook, Twitter and YouTube. Facebook support group.

SDA is a registered NFP charity, endorsed by the Australian Tax Office as a Deductible Gift Recipient.
